Time-Resolved XUV-induced Electron Solvation Dynamics in Water Clusters — •Rupert Michiels1, Aaron LaForge1, Carlo Callegari2, Marcel Drabbels3, Paola Finetti2, Oksana Plekan2, Kevin C. Prince2, Stefano Stranges4, Matthias Bohlen1, Mykola Shcherbinin1, and Frank Stienkemeier1 — 1Universität Freiburg, Germany — 2Elettra-Sincrotrone, Trieste, Italy — 3EPFL Lausanne, Switzerland — 4University of Rome, Italy
The solvation of electrons in aqueous solutions plays a nearly ubiquitous role in biological and chemical systems although a fundamental understanding of its properties (e.g. solvation time, binding energies, solvation shells, and binding motifs) has yet to be fully attained. Here, we report on solvated water clusters induced by XUV ionization followed by electron recapture. The binding energies of the solvated electron were measured in a pump-probe scheme as a function of cluster size in which we found solvation times in the femtosecond to picosecond range.
